Compensair can help you claim up to €600 from the airline, if one of the following happened to you:
- your flight was delayed for more than 3 hours
- your flight was cancelled in less than 14 days before departure
- you missed your connection flight and arrived to your final destination more than 3 hours late
- you were not allowed to board because of overbooking
Necessary prerequisites:
- delay was not caused by weather or other extraordinary conditions
- the flights must have taken place within the past 6 years
- departure from EU or destination in EU or both
